Output 3ca5f10207c525d2e9525555840069700b285ab006d425e584fce2bba4ed58b7:166

value
150134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ad27520eff8db8c748c59f0fa24bd7a9e6fcb0 OP_EQUAL
address
3Dy7uAv9MZQ8RvPeVbo9oFWkYW1ETabY7D
transaction
3ca5f10207c525d2e9525555840069700b285ab006d425e584fce2bba4ed58b7